Not all lanes pay the same…
and it’s not random.

A lot of owner-operators think it comes down to luck or just “what’s available” that day.

But there’s actually a reason behind it.

Take a state like Texas for example.
There’s consistently a high volume of freight moving in and out… which can be a good thing.

But here’s the flip side:
Because there’s so much activity, there are also a lot of trucks competing for those same loads.

So, depending on where you’re positioned and how you move,
you can either do really well… or end up taking lower rates just to stay moving.

Some lanes pay more because:
• There’s higher demand than available trucks
• Fewer drivers want to run that route
• It’s harder to reload coming back

And some lanes consistently pay less because:
• They’re oversaturated
• Too many trucks, not enough strong-paying freight
• Everyone is chasing the same “popular” routes

So, if you’re running the same lanes over and over and the numbers aren’t adding up…
it might not be the work.

It might be positioning.

A big part of maximizing your week isn’t just finding loads,
it’s knowing:
👉 where to go
👉 when to go there
👉 and how to set yourself up for the next move

That’s how you avoid getting stuck working hard without seeing it in your numbers.

Fuel prices change everything.

But most owner-operators aren’t using that to their advantage when it comes to rates.

When diesel goes up, your cost per mile goes up.
But if you’re just accepting loads without factoring that in… you’re the one absorbing the hit.

This is where experience matters.

A good dispatcher isn’t just finding loads, they’re:
• Watching fuel trends
• Understanding current lane demand
• Using that information to negotiate better rates

Because brokers already know what fuel is doing.
The question is… are you pushing back or just accepting what’s offered?

Even small rate adjustments can make a big difference over the course of a week.

Most owner-operators don’t lose money because of bad loads…
They lose it in between the loads.

Deadhead miles.
Waiting too long to book the next run.
Taking whatever’s available instead of planning ahead.

A lot of drivers are running hard but not actually maximizing their weekly gross.

One small shift I focus on when dispatching:
→ Planning the next load BEFORE the current one is done

That alone can be the difference between an average week and a strong one.
